D5.D.10.3 Clause 6.3.2.3(1) – LTB for rolled sections or equivalent welded section

The NBN-NA recommends the use of the values specified in EN 1993-1-1 for the LTB factors λLT0 and β. However it gives two different sets of values for λLT0 and β based on two different conditions as give below:

  1. If Mcr is determined by considering the properties of the gross cross section and the lateral restraints, the following values are used:

    λLT0 =0.2 and β = 1.0

  2. If Mcr is determined by ignoring the lateral restraints, the following values are used:

    λLT0 =0.4 and β = 0.75

The program evaluates which factors to use based on the CMN parameter. If CMN = 1.0 (default) or = 0.7, then the program assumes the restraints are ignored and the second set of values is used for λLT0 and β. If CMN = 0.5, then the first set of λLT0 and β values is used.

These factors are then applied to equation 6.57 of NBN-EN to evaluate the Lateral Torsional Buckling reduction factor χLT.
